Without Drama, Nugie Reveals Simple Riders Before Performing
JAKARTA - Soloist who is also a member of The Dance Company, Nugie, admitted that he never had excessive riders submitted to concert organizers or promoters.
Having had a career in the music industry since the mid-1990s, Katon Bagaskara's younger brother said the request he always asked for was room for smoking before going on stage.
"Oh, I never had a crucial record of riders. What is certain is that one thing that must be provided with the committee is the smoke area. That's all, it's done," Nugie told the media crew in Kemang, South Jakarta, Monday, July 14.
"If you don't have an air conditioner, it's like a place, there's no problem for me, the important thing is that there is a smoke area and it can be alone, it's not crowded," he added.
The reason is, the 53-year-old musician needs a room to stay in contact before a gig. Even that request is not required to have complete facilities.

"Yes, for me, it's just my riders. It's easy. So, the committees don't have to be complicated when they call me, the important thing is that there are smoke areas and I'm not fussy about the others and I can drink coffee. That's it," he said again.
The same thing was also applied when appearing with The Dance Company Ariyo Wahab, Baim, and Pongki No excessive riders were asked to the organizers.
Even then I brought it to this band. The important thing is, basically everything is accommodated, like Baim has snacks, Pongki has fruit, Ariyo has drinks, I also have like that. Each of us, the most important thing is first, not strange needs. Don't ask for something that can't be done," he said.
"If it's important for us, 'Oh, instead of getting away from the stage, looking for a smoking area, because I'm lazy all the way looking for it, I have to run to the stage, so I just ask for a place as close as possible to smoke the area. That's right, if it's weird, I think it depends on them," he concluded.
